Abstract: A display apparatus includes a first pixel driving circuit, an electric field blocking layer on the first pixel driving circuit, a second pixel driving circuit on the electric field blocking layer, and a first display element and a second display element on the second pixel driving circuit, wherein each of the first pixel driving circuit and the second pixel driving circuit includes at least one thin film transistor, the first pixel driving circuit overlaps with the second pixel driving circuit, the first display element is connected with the first pixel driving circuit, and the second display element is connected with the second pixel driving circuit.

Abstract: Embodiments of the disclosure concern display devices. The voltage line for supplying driving voltage to the cathode electrode of the light emitting element in the subpixel and the voltage line for supplying voltage for initializing the subpixel are integrated together. This allows for use of fewer voltage lines in the active area, along with easier arrangement of the voltage lines. The wire resistance may be reduced by adjusting the width of the voltage lines. The reduction in wire resistance may decrease brightness deviation or increase the aperture ratio or transmittance of the subpixel, thus allowing the display device higher light emission efficiency or transmittance.

Abstract: Disclosed is a thin film transistor substrate comprising a substrate; a first thin film transistor on the substrate, the first thin film transistor including a first active layer and a first gate electrode; a second thin film transistor on the substrate, the second thin film transistor including a second active layer and a second gate electrode above the first active layer and the first gate electrode; a first insulating layer between the first gate electrode and the second active layer; and; and a first connection electrode connecting together the first active layer and the second active layer, the first connection electrode extending through a first contact hole in the first insulating layer and is in contact with each of the first active layer and the second active layer and a display apparatus including the same.
